Venues near Santa Fe, Philippines

If we have no Venues in the exact location, we show the closest we have.
It could be wide because we show only venues with dishes on their menu.

Best in Santa Fe

Santa Fe, Philippines
11.18556 124.91611
3.149.247.123
BESbswy